Sangamon County elects local officials

November 12, 2008
By Nicole Calcagno
Staff Writer

•The race for Circuit Clerk pitted the incumbent Tony Libri (R) against Cecilia Tumulty (D). It was a very close race, but Libri received roughly 52 percent of the vote, while Tumulty received roughly 47 percent.

•In the Coroner’s race, Susan Boone (R) was the incumbent. She went up against Angela “Aby” Phoenix (D). Boone received roughly 58 percent of the vote while Phoenix received roughly 44 percent.

•The race for State’s Attorney was another close one. The incumbent, John Schmidt (R) faced Ron Stradt (D). Schmidt received roughly 53 percent of the vote, Stradt roughly 46 percent.

•A position not won by a Republican was that of County Recorder. Neither candidate was the incumbent.. Don Gray (R) was up against Joshua “Josh” Langfelder (D). Langfelder received roughly 55 percent of the vote while Gray received roughly 44 percent.

•There was one county spot that ran unopposed. The spot of Auditor
remained with the incumbent, Paul Palazzollo.
